How to Take Your Dog Shopping

  • Fun and Games
  • Travel
  • shopping

Unless you have a medical reason to do so, you’re generally not allowed to take your dog shopping in the U.S. All but a few American stores have a clear rule regarding the subject, and it’s a rule made visible via a “No Pets Allowed” sign. What’s interesting about this rule is that it isn’t stringently enforced in some other countries. Europe for example, has no problem with doggie customers.
